Dna methylation at cpg islands silences gene expression: cpg islands= a regulatory element of some eukaryotic genes, which is unusually rich in. If activators aren"t there any more then cpg islands become methylated. Homozygous for a2: when passed on to the offspring they only express a1 because a2 was imprinted= inactivated, expression of allele depends on the parent that transmits it. In genomic imprinting, the copy of a gene an individual inherits from one parent is transcriptionally inactive while the copy inherited from the other parent is active. If deletion is passed from man to child, both sons and daughters would each have 50% chance of receiving a deleted paternal allele. Dna methylation must be reset during meiosis before being passed on to the next generation. If this were not true, the imprinting would not be sex-specific: those children would express the mutant phenotype, b/c intact copy inherited from their mother is inactive.
